Snoopy Island, because it resembles the cartoon dog lying on its back, is a small rocky island floating off the coast of Fujairah in Al Aqah. You can try to swim to the rock from the private hotel beach (for a fee), or the public beach side—though the latter may only be possible when the tide is low and waters are calm.
You can book a snorkeling tour of Snoopy Island which may also include other water activities like kayaking, diving, and standup paddleboarding in Fujairah.

Went for one night for snorkelling and mountains. Boats and kayaking was off limits as too windy which meant the sea life were around as no boat traffic. We borrowed life jackets from the lovely Royal M hotel and swan over with snorkels as this is what we came for.
I had the incredible experience of seeing a large slow moving Sand bar shark passing slowly right in front of me! In 3 ft deep water. I may have attracted him as my bright gold watch may have caught his eye? I was in disbelief at what I saw and didn’t panic just made sure he kept going past and decided it was time I headed back to the beach asap. I found my daughter and made the ten minute swim back to beach. We also saw the beautiful parrot fishes, starfish and many smaller colourful fish and loads of huge Black Sea urchins in the shallow reef by the island. Beach side the reef is very shallow 3 ft deep. I ventured round the back the water was deep with low visibility and very windy so quickly came back to the safety of the shallow reef.
The hotel was excellent with a clean sandy beach with life guards. The drive there was scenic passing sand dunes camels and mountains.

Swam out to snoopy island from the public beach side. There were globs of tar floating everywhere in the water.....which got stuck in my hair, my snorkeling mask and my bathing suit. I was so dissapointed, because otherwise the reefs were beautiful, with clear water and lots of tropical fish in the reefs. The tar was impossible to avoid and i had to get out of the water after 7 mins or so because it was all over my snorkel mask. Had to throw away my gear, flip flops and new bathing suit as they were covered in tar stains.
